This bug was fixed in the package libg15 - 1.2.7-2ubuntu2 --------------- libg15 (1.2.7-2ubuntu2) wily; urgency=medium
* debian/patches/00-fix-reinit.patch: fixed re_initLibG15() to properly reset internal state, allowing g15daemon to continue working after keyboard was replugged and after suspend or hibernate.
